• unknown's avatar
    Fixed bug #17164. · c0579144
    unknown authored
    If the WHERE condition of a query contained an ORed FALSE term
    then the set of tables whose rows cannot serve for null complements
    in outer joins was determined incorrectly. It resulted in blocking 
    possible conversions of outer joins into joins for such queries.
    
    
    mysql-test/r/join_outer.result:
      Added a test case for bug #17164.
    mysql-test/t/join_outer.test:
      Added a test case for bug #17164.
    c0579144
join_outer.result 37.9 KB